Description

A 2 or 3 day course that will focus on the proper procedure in the discovery and exhumation of buried remains and surface skeletons. Target Audience: This course is designed for law enforcement investigators, first responders and prosecutorial attorneys whose responsibilities would include the exhumation, examination and identification of deceased individuals. Course Objectives: The primary objectives are to provide the student with the skills needed to identify gravesites and to properly document, exhume, collect, process and preserve evidence. Also students will learn to approximately identify the race and sex of the skeletal remains. Upon completion of this course, students should be able to: Examine topography layout for possible grave sites, describe procedure for proper exhumation of skeletal remains. Course Requirements: Complete attendance by all participants. Student participation to include: Classroom involvement, practical field exercise (exhumation), Crime scene techniques involving surface skeletons and buried bodies

Class Requirements: This class has a lot of hands on activity. Please dress according to the weather (No suits or ties) All participants must wear boots that are above the ankle. Due to the terrain we will be working in and around.
